About Bachelor of Physiotherapy or BPT

 An undergraduate degree called the Bachelor of Physiotherapy, or BPT, focuses on the anatomy of the human body. This curriculum has a four-year term, and students must perform a six-month internship when the program's tenure is over. Physical variables including heat, electricity, mechanical pressure and mechanical forces are used in physiotherapy as a kind of therapy. Physical therapy is used to preserve and restore a person's full range of motion and functional abilities across their lifetime. Physiotherapy assists in the treatment of illnesses without the use of medications. The complex functioning of bones, muscles, and nerves are well understood by physiotherapists, who are also well-versed in human anatomy. Eligibility

Candidates for the Bachelor of Physiotherapy programme must possess the following qualifications:


- Completion of the 10+2 from a recognised board with a minimum grade point average of 50%.


- Completed the 10+2 with Biology, Chemistry, and Physics as required subjects.


- English proficiency is a must for applicants.


- At the time of admission, candidates must have reached the age of 17.


Duration 

The BPT undergraduate curriculum lasts four years and includes a six-month mandatory internship.

Subjects taught in BPT

Anatomy, Physiology, Clinical Biochemistry, General Psychology, Basic Nursing & First Aid, Ethics in Physiotherapy Practice, English, Computer, and many other subjects are covered in the first-year BPT programme. The subjects become more challenging after the first year and are devised by the universities.

Scope

Candidates with a bachelor's degree in physiotherapy, or BPT, have a wide range of employment prospects, including:


Fitness and Health Centers.


Industrial Health Industries


Multinational Corporations maintain the employees' health


Independent Private Physiotherapist


Lecturer


Researcher
